    About Marilì

    Marilì, with its delicate Italian lilt, offers a fresh take on classic femininity. This rare gem, blending Hebrew and Latin roots, evokes a sense of gentle elegance and soft exoticism, perfect for parents seeking a name that feels both familiar and distinctly unique. While its origins hint at meanings like "bitter" or "sea of bitterness" from Mary, it also carries the warmth of "beloved," perhaps a reflection of its melodic sound. Marilì stands apart from other elegant names by being a truly uncommon choice, offering a subtle nod to European charm without being overtly trendy. It’s a name that whispers sophistication, ideal for a family who cherishes understated beauty and a touch of continental grace.
